The Role

As a Group Financial Planning and Analysis Manager, you’ll sit at the centre of the Group planning cycle, partnering with Finance, FP&A and Treasury to deliver high-quality forecasting, analysis and management information. You and your team will produce robust outputs across Budget, the 5-year Corporate Plan and monthly rolling forecasts, as well as ICAAP, Recovery Plan and stress testing, ensuring submissions are well controlled, aligned to IFRS and regulatory expectations, and supported by clear insight on movements, risks and opportunities for Executive Committee and Board review.

As a Group Financial Planning and Analysis Manager, you will:

  • Support the production of Group financial forecasts across the annual Budget, 5-year Corporate Plan, monthly rolling forecasts, ICAAP, Recovery Plan and stress testing.
  • Prepare detailed forecast models, supporting schedules and analysis for Group-level submissions.
  • Coordinate with Finance and FP&A teams to collect, validate and analyse divisional forecast inputs.
  • Work closely with Treasury and the Savings team to produce accurate capital and funding plans.
  • Prepare clear analysis explaining movements versus prior forecasts, Budget and prior periods, escalating key risks and opportunities.
  • Support delivery of materials for Executive Committee and Board reviews, contributing to the monthly management reporting cycle.
  • Identify and drive continuous improvement in budgeting and consolidation processes.
  • Investigate variances and unusual trends, escalating issues and insights to support quarterly trading updates and investor relations activity.
  • Support development, maintenance and operation of Group planning platforms and forecasting tools.

What We’re Looking For

We’re looking for someone who can combine strong technical FP&A expertise with clear communication and a drive to continuously improve forecasting and consolidation processes.

  • FP&A experience, within UK banking or financial services, supporting Group-level budgeting, forecasting and reporting.
  • Strong understanding of Group planning cycles, consolidation and bank balance sheets, including capital and funding planning.
  • Good working knowledge of IFRS (including IFRS 9) and the regulatory forecasting environment (ICAAP, Recovery Planning and stress testing).
  • Advanced financial modelling and analytical capability, with experience working with large, complex data sets.
  • Clear, confident communicator with experience partnering with senior finance stakeholders across multiple teams.
  • Highly organised with strong attention to detail, able to prioritise and deliver to tight deadlines.
  • Qualified ACCA/CIMA or Degree in quantitative or Business subject.
